The peaceful protest of Punjabi University’s Assistant Professors (guest faculty) has entered its 100th day. For over three months, the educators have been sitting on a peaceful protest, seeking recognition of their contributions and a salary hike.
They have also been critical of a lack of dialogue from the administration, saying, “Orders from the Punjab and Haryana High Court guaranteeing fair pay have been ignored, and every appeal has been met with indifference.”
The teachers have made repeated attempts to engage the administration in dialogue, but their efforts, they say, have been futile. The educators are demanding a basic salary of Rs 57,700. —TNS
